Responsible for auditing the Master Production Schedule (Heijunka Board) to ensure material is available to support the build and pack schedule. Your responsibilities will include Assist in managing inventory during phase-in/phase-out transitions to minimize operational disruptions Perform cycle counting to resolve material related inventory discrepancies as needed Assist in resolving purchase order receipt delays by coordinating with Receiving and Material Planning Bachelor's degree in Business, Operations Mgt., Supply Chain, or related field, or a minimum of 5 years relevant experience in a manufacturing or assembly environment with concentration on material flow, production assembly, and/or raw material warehousing and deployment Basic knowledge of Supply Chain Planning concepts and application. Working knowledge of Microsoft Office applications (i.e. Excel and Outlook). Strong verbal and written communication skills with the ability to effectively communicate across multiple levels of the organization. Lifting of 30 pounds overhead occasionally. Familiarity with Lean concepts such as Pull Planning, Kanban, and Heijunka a plus
